第一章:初识微信小程序
1.1 微信小程序是什么?
微信小程序是一种不需要下载安装即可使用的应用,它实现了应用“触手可及”的理念,用户扫一扫或搜一下即可打开应用。微信小程序无需安装即可使用,用户扫一扫或者搜一下即可打开应用。这种无需下载安装即可使用的应用,能够更加方便快捷地触达用户。
1.2 微信小程序的优势
- 无需安装,即点即用:用户无需下载安装即可使用,降低了使用门槛。
- 触达率高:微信拥有庞大的用户群体,小程序可以通过微信生态实现高效触达。
- 开发成本较低:相对于原生APP开发,小程序的开发成本较低。
- 快速迭代:小程序的开发周期相对较短,可以快速迭代和更新。
第二章:微信小程序开发环境搭建
2.1 开发工具准备
微信小程序的开发需要以下工具:
- 微信开发者工具:提供小程序开发、预览和调试等功能。
- 微信Web开发者工具:提供Web页面开发、预览和调试等功能。
2.2 环境搭建步骤
- 下载并安装微信开发者工具。
- 创建小程序项目。
- 配置项目设置。
- 开始编写代码。
第三章:微信小程序基本架构
3.1 页面结构
微信小程序页面主要由以下部分组成:
- XML:页面结构描述文件,用于定义页面的布局和元素。
- WXML:页面结构文件,用于描述页面内容的结构。
- WXSS:页面样式表文件,用于定义页面的样式。
- JavaScript:页面逻辑文件,用于定义页面的交互和数据处理。
3.2 组件
微信小程序提供了一系列组件,方便开发者快速搭建页面。
- 视图容器:如
view、scroll-view等。 - 基础内容:如
text、image等。 - 表单组件:如
input、checkbox等。 - 导航组件:如
navigator等。 - 媒体组件:如
audio、video等。 - 地图组件:如
map等。
第四章:微信小程序实战案例
4.1 实战案例一:简单的音乐播放器
4.1.1 案例目标
本案例将带你一步步开发一个简单的音乐播放器。
4.1.2 案例步骤
- 创建小程序项目。
- 编写XML和WXML文件,搭建音乐播放器页面结构。
- 编写WXSS文件,设置音乐播放器样式。
- 编写JavaScript文件,实现音乐播放器的逻辑。
4.2 实战案例二:微信小程序购物车
4.2.1 案例目标
本案例将带你开发一个微信小程序购物车。
4.2.2 案例步骤
- 创建小程序项目。
- 编写XML和WXML文件,搭建购物车页面结构。
- 编写WXSS文件,设置购物车样式。
- 编写JavaScript文件,实现购物车的逻辑。
第五章:微信小程序优化与推广
5.1 小程序优化
- 页面加载优化:优化页面结构,减少页面大小,提高页面加载速度。
- 性能优化:优化代码,提高小程序的运行效率。
- 用户体验优化:优化界面设计,提高用户体验。
5.2 小程序推广
- 利用微信生态:通过微信朋友圈、公众号等渠道进行推广。
- 搜索引擎优化:优化小程序关键词,提高搜索排名。
- 社交媒体推广:利用微博、抖音等社交媒体平台进行推广。
第六章:总结
通过本章的学习,你已初步掌握了微信小程序开发的基础知识和实战技能。在实际开发过程中,还需不断学习和积累经验。相信只要你用心去打造,一定能够打造出爆款应用!
